The recent announcement of fresh congress in Imo State chapter of the All Progressive Congress, APC may be another recipe for fresh chaos.

Governor Rochas Okorocha had said congresses in the party will hold from Friday, July 20th, Saturday, July 21 and Monday, July 23rd, 2018.

The Governor’s camp had lost out in the party’s congress in the State as the Coalition- a group of politicians opposed to the State Governor- won from the ward to the State levels.

This snowballed into a bitter war between the Governor’s camp and the Coalition at the national convention of the party held in Abuja. Senator Osita Izunaso, a top chieftain of the Coalition lost his re- election bid to the post of National Organizing Secretary to Hon Emma Ibediro, sponsored by Governor Okorocha.

Legal hostilities resumed after the political showdown between both camps at the APC national convention held in Abuja.

A Federal High Court in Owerri nullified the congresses in the party in the State. The Coalition has proceeded to the Appeal Court to challenge the judgment.

With Primaries fast approaching, the Okorocha camp insists on holding congresses, a move countered by the Coalition which in a statement called on party members to disregard.

According to a statement by Chief Okey Ikoro, Chairman, APC Stakeholders Forum, he called on party faithful to shun the purported congress as Congress in Imo State has been concluded and approved by the National Working Committee, NWC and affirmed during the National Convention of the party.

“Also any other issues about the Congress is before a court of competent jurisdiction and any action taking by the governor and his handful of supporters is prejudiced.

“We urge all party members to remain calm and ignore the governor and his arrangee Congress, as non of that can stand the test of time.
